Skip to content
This repository has been archived by the owner on Jun 30, 2021. It is now read-only.

Dropping packages: Gnu stack and more #1165

Closed
a-schaefers opened this issue Aug 28, 2020 · 24 comments · Fixed by #1313
Closed

Dropping packages: Gnu stack and more #1165

a-schaefers opened this issue Aug 28, 2020 · 24 comments · Fixed by #1313

Comments

@a-schaefers
Copy link
Contributor

a-schaefers commented Aug 28, 2020

It has been fun, but life and work is getting the way of being able to maintain this, so first come first serve. Open a PR adding a space to the end of the 'version' file to claim your package(s), and reply here so I can cross off the list.

bc
coreutils
dash
diffutils
ed
emacs
emacs-git
emacs-nox

expect
findutils
gawk
gnu-netcat
gnugrep
gnupg2
gnutls
gtar
iproute2
iptables
iputils
kmod

libassuan
libcap
libgcrypt
libgpg-error

libksba
libxaw3d
lzip
lzo
mksh
nawk-git

nettle
npth
openvpn
patch
pciutils
pinentry
pkcs11-helper
procps-ng
readline
sed
shadow
strace
wget

@dilyn-corner
Copy link
Contributor

I'll probably take a couple; some of these are needed for KISS-kde. I'll take a closer look later.

@magenbluten
Copy link
Contributor

i have interest / need the following packages and could take over maintenance:

  • mksh
  • iproute2
  • openvpn
  • iptables
  • strace
  • maybe: iputils
  • maybe: sed

@periish
Copy link
Contributor

periish commented Aug 29, 2020

I'll take lzip, readline, ed, dash, bc, patch, gnugrep, and gnupg2.

@periish
Copy link
Contributor

periish commented Aug 29, 2020

Update: #1167 is my PR.

@a-schaefers
Copy link
Contributor Author

i have interest / need the following packages and could take over maintenance:

  • mksh
  • iproute2
  • openvpn
  • iptables
  • strace
  • maybe: iputils
  • maybe: sed

Open a PR claiming them as yours or I can't cross them off the list.

@cemkeylan
Copy link
Contributor

cemkeylan commented Aug 30, 2020

Wow, I am seeing we are having a buffet once again! I would like to order

  • Coreutils
  • Emacs* and dependencies
  • gnutls and dependencies
  • libxaw3d
  • wget

I will send the PR tomorrow, I might add to this list.

@cemkeylan
Copy link
Contributor

Okay, here is the full list of packages I have taken:

  • coreutils
  • diffutils
  • emacs*
  • gawk
  • gnutls
  • libxaw3d
  • nettle
  • pciutils
  • procps-ng
  • wget

@a-schaefers
Copy link
Contributor Author

Thanks @periish and @cemkeylan , list updated.

dylanaraps pushed a commit that referenced this issue Aug 31, 2020
- coreutils
- diffutils
- emacs*
- gawk
- gnutls
- libxaw3d
- nettle
- pciutils
- procps-ng
- wget

Maintainer change under issue #1165 on kisslinux/community
@dilyn-corner
Copy link
Contributor

@periish might also want to talk libassuan, libgcrypt, and libgpg-error (all are required by gnupg2).
@aicsx or @mmatongo might want libcap.
Otherwise, I'll take the aforementioned.

@mmatongo
Copy link
Contributor

mmatongo commented Aug 31, 2020

I'll take lipcapand gnu-netcat

@periish
Copy link
Contributor

periish commented Aug 31, 2020

Will you fix #1150?

@mmatongo
Copy link
Contributor

Will you fix #1150?

Let me get on it now

@CamilleScholtz
Copy link
Contributor

CamilleScholtz commented Aug 31, 2020

I can take:

  • libgcrypt
  • libgpg-error
  • lzo

#1183

@dylanaraps
Copy link
Owner

lzo has already been adopted. @onodera-punpun

See: https://github.com/kisslinux/community/pull/1174/files

@a-schaefers
Copy link
Contributor Author

#1174 thank you @magenbluten

@a-schaefers
Copy link
Contributor Author

Thank you also @onodera-punpun & @mmatongo

list updated

@dylanaraps
Copy link
Owner

dylanaraps commented Sep 9, 2020

Last orphans:

  • expect
  • findutils
  • libassuan
  • npth
  • shadow
  • pinentry

@periish libassuan, npth and pinentry are around solely for gnupg2 which is one of your packages, care to adopt these?

I will adopt the remainder of the packages.

jedahan pushed a commit to jedahan/community that referenced this issue Sep 10, 2020
- coreutils
- diffutils
- emacs*
- gawk
- gnutls
- libxaw3d
- nettle
- pciutils
- procps-ng
- wget

Maintainer change under issue dylanaraps#1165 on kisslinux/community
@periish
Copy link
Contributor

periish commented Sep 10, 2020

I shall do so soon

@Vouivre
Copy link
Contributor

Vouivre commented Sep 11, 2020

Which packages will you adopt @dylanaraps ? npth, libassuan and pinentry ?

I didn't want to adopt these, because I don't use them, I know only pinentry. But it seems they are pretty easy to maintain. So I could adopt them, so you will have more time to improve KISS 😉 . What do you think ?

If you agree, I will do the change next week.

@dylanaraps
Copy link
Owner

@Vouivre All packages have been adopted if periish takes over npth, libassuan and pinentry.

@Vouivre
Copy link
Contributor

Vouivre commented Sep 11, 2020

Next time I will read the whole comment.....

Ok, I'll wait for the confirmation.

@dylanaraps
Copy link
Owner

@cemkeylan
Copy link
Contributor

@periish @dylanaraps I can take the gnupg2 stack since I am already maintaining those at home as well. If you would want that, of course.

@dylanaraps
Copy link
Owner

@cemkeylan npth, libassuan and pinentry are yours. gnupg2 maintainership depends on @periish though I'm really leaning towards just giving it to you. It has been out-of-date since August 27 (2.2.22, 2.2.23) and seeing as it is security focused (and one of the releases is a security fix)... I'm sure everyone can understand.

You know what @cemkeylan? They're all yours. I want to close this issue, #1224 and #1225, they've been open long enough.

@periish While on the topic of outdated stuff, another reminder for NSS which hasn't been updated since July 24 (3.55, 3.56). Update is of arguable importance as it's used by qt5-webengine for certificate stuff. Let me know if you don't have the time (or if there are any technical issues delaying update, etc) and I'll take over maintenance short term (or long term). Am happy to do this, just let me know (same goes for any other outdated packages you have). :)

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

Successfully merging a pull request may close this issue.

9 participants